I have a new problem. When I try to run msconfig, regedit or task manager, they closes immediately. I assume I have a virus. I have run various anti-virus programs and Spybot, (in safe mode also), but nothing fixes the problem.

Use the Doug Knox utility mentioned at the bottom of this article:
Or do it yourself by making a new folder, and placing copies of regedit.exe, msconfig.exe, and taskmgr.exe into the new folder. Rename the files redit.com, mscfg.com and tmgr.com

They should then be usable. Task Manager is particularly important to see what alien process is running. Or use Process Explorer:
I any case you need to kill the rogue process.

You should if possible then:

. do two online AV scans. Trend Micro and Panda are good choices.
. Run AdAware with current definitions
. Run Hijack This to see if there are persistent entries

You can also simply rename regedit to something else (i.e. rgdt.exe), that fools the virus and regedit will launch. Same for msconfig (i.e. cnfg.exe).
